Summary
Directs the government to consider naming Ansar Allah a terrorist group to stop their attacks on ships and people in the Middle East.
What problem does this solve?
The Houthi group, Ansar Allah, has repeatedly attacked U.S. military ships, civilian ships, and U.S. partners, which threatens trade and safety. This order begins the process of officially calling them a terrorist group, which helps cut off their resources and stop their attacks.
What does this order do?
Initiates terrorist designation process
Orders the Secretary of State to begin the process of officially naming Ansar Allah, also known as the Houthis, as a Foreign Terrorist Organization.
Requires a report on designation
Mandates the Secretary of State, with intelligence and treasury officials, to give the President a report about the designation within 30 days.
Reviews aid partners in Yemen
Requires a review of all U.S. aid partners in Yemen after the designation to find any that have paid or supported Ansar Allah.
Cuts funding to certain aid groups
Directs the head of USAID to end projects, grants, or contracts with any aid groups found to have inappropriate ties to Ansar Allah.

What is the real world impact?
•
Protects U.S. personnel and allies
Aims to stop attacks on U.S. Navy ships and regional partners like Saudi Arabia, the UAE, and Israel by cutting off the Houthis' resources.
•
Secures global trade routes
Responds to over 100 attacks on commercial vessels in the Red Sea, which have killed sailors and raised global prices by forcing ships to take longer routes.
When does this start?
This order sets multiple deadlines for government action, starting from January 22, 2025.
Report on terrorist designation
Within 30 days of the order (by February 21, 2025), the Secretary of State must submit a report to the President about designating Ansar Allah as a terrorist group.
Action on designation
Within 15 days after the report is submitted, the Secretary of State must take all appropriate action regarding the designation.
